The Story of Myer

Myer is a variant of Meyer, from the German Meier (also Maier, Mayer), meaning farmer, steward, or overseer of land. In medieval Germany, a Meier was a free tenant farmer or village headman — a position of responsibility and respect. The name entered Ashkenazi Jewish culture as a surname and given name during the surname adoption period of the 18th and 19th centuries, where it became especially prominent.

Myer as a first name follows the trend of using distinguished Jewish surnames as given names, similar to Cohen, Levi, and Asher. It appeals to families seeking names that honor heritage while remaining modern and accessible.

In Ashkenazi Jewish culture, Meyer/Myer has a long history as both a surname and a given name. It carries associations with achievement, scholarship, and the values of the Jewish intellectual tradition.
